    Competition Overview

    Bennington College Young Writers Awards

    The Bennington College Young Writers Awards is an annual competition established to celebrate and promote exceptional writing among high school students. With a rich literary heritage that includes twelve Pulitzer Prize winners and three U.S. poet laureates, Bennington College aims to encourage young writers to pursue their passion for literature. 

    Eligibility

    • Open to students in grades 9 through 12 worldwide.

    Submission Deadline
    • November 1.

    • The contest opens September 1. 

    Official Website

    Subject Categories

    • Poetry: A collection of three poems.

    • Fiction: A short story (1,500 words or fewer) or a one-act play (running time of fewer than 30 minutes).

    • Nonfiction: A personal or academic essay (1,500 words or fewer).

    Requirements

    Submission Categories

    • Choose one category only:

      • Poetry: 3 poems

      • Fiction / Nonfiction: Max 1,500 words  

    • Word count includes headers, footers, footnotes, titles, bibliographies  

    • One submission per year, per student  

    • Submissions will not be returned  

    Citation

    • Cite all sources properly if used  

    • File format not specified—submit in Word or PDF  

    Originality Requirement

    • All work must be original  

    • Plagiarism checks enforced  

    • Plagiarized work will be disqualified  

    Sponsorship Requirement

    • A sponsor teacher must review and approve each entry  

    • Homeschooled students must have a mentor sponsor  

    • Sponsor serves as main contact for submission  

    Prizes

    Cash Awards
    First Place
    $1,000
    Second Place
    $500
    Third Place
    $250
    Scholarships
    • Winners who apply, are admitted, and enroll at Bennington College will receive a $15,000 scholarship annually for four years, totaling $60,000.

    • Finalists who apply, are admitted, and enroll will receive a $10,000 scholarship annually for four years, totaling $40,000.
